How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Berkeley?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Berkeley Studio Apartments | $863 | $700 | $1,027 |
| Berkeley 1 Bedroom Apartments | $921 | $680 | $1,259 |
| Berkeley 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,114 | $813 | $3,557 |
| Berkeley 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,742 | $1,250 | $5,407 |
| Berkeley 4 Bedroom Apartments | $3,099 | $1,500 | $4,699 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Berkeley Apartments with Washer/Dryer
How much is the average rent for Berkeley Apartments with Washer/Dryer?
The average rent for a Apartment in Berkeley with Washer/Dryer is $1,114.
What is the largest Berkeley Apartment for rent with Washer/Dryer?
Today's Apartment with Washer/Dryer and the most square footage in Berkeley is a 1,750 square feet unit starting from $1,250 at The Mint Townhomes.
What is the average size for Berkeley Apartments for rent with Washer/Dryer?
The average size for a rental with Washer/Dryer in Berkeley is currently at 847 sq ft.
